Can I tour the White House?
Yes you can, however Concierge Tours will not be able to guide you. Tour tickets are limited and can only be obtained through your local Congress Representative and after you and your entire party pass the Security Background check. Concierge Tours will take you to the White House and provide facts and stories regarding this iconic building. (Fun fact: The original name was not White House; it was ‘Presidential Mansion’.)
